Comparable Facts

Compare George C Wallace Community College Dothan in Dothan, AL with Jefferson State Community College in Birmingham, AL on tuition, admissions, graduation, earnings, and student body data using the table above.

Jefferson State Community College is larger than WCCD based on total student enrollment (9,240 students vs. 4,044 students)

Location, institution type, and student-faculty ratio

  • George C Wallace Community College Dothan is located in Dothan, AL (Small City setting); Jefferson State Community College is in Birmingham, AL (Midsize City setting).
  • George C Wallace Community College Dothan is a public, non-profit 2-year institution. Jefferson State Community College is a public, non-profit 2-year institution.
  • Student-to-faculty ratio: George C Wallace Community College Dothan 14:1; Jefferson State Community College 19:1.

WCCD vs. JSCC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, WCCD or JSCC?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at George C Wallace Community College Dothan than JSCC ($476 vs. $8,778).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at George C Wallace Community College Dothan are 40.6% lower than at Jefferson State Community College ($9,450 vs. $15,921).
  • Jefferson State Community College is 2.4% more expensive for in-state tuition than WCCD (about $120 more per year; $5,100.00 vs. $4,980.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 1.4% higher at JSCC than at George C Wallace Community College Dothan (about $120 more per year; $8,970.00 vs. $8,850.00).
  • A larger share of students receive grant aid at George C Wallace Community College Dothan than at Jefferson State Community College (83% vs. 70%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by George C Wallace Community College Dothan students is 36.7% larger than aid received by Jefferson State Community College students ($8,616 vs. $6,302).

WCCD vs. JSCC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for WCCD and JSCC?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• Graduates from Jefferson State Community College earn a median of about $3,000 more per year than WCCD graduates about ten years after starting college ($32,800 vs. $29,800),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
